Bill Summary
Affirming the support of the House of Delegates for the passage by Congress of the National Concealed Carry Reciprocity Act.
AI Summary
This resolution affirms the West Virginia House of Delegates' support for the National Concealed Carry Reciprocity Act (HR38), a proposed federal law that would require all U.S. states to recognize concealed carry permits issued by other states. The resolution notes that while every state currently has its own concealed carry weapons laws with varying requirements, the proposed act would create a national standard similar to how driver's licenses are recognized across state lines. Specifically, the resolution requests that Congress pass the Constitutional Concealed Carry Reciprocity Act, which would allow West Virginia residents with valid concealed carry permits to carry their weapons in other states that permit concealed carry, without needing to verify the specific details of permit recognition in each state. As part of the resolution, the House of Delegates instructs the Clerk to forward a copy of the resolution to West Virginia's congressional delegation to communicate their support for the legislation.
